## TRACE

1. **Test** — concrete, falsifiable, relevant and safely investigable question.
2. **Register** — sources, dates, definitions and retention status.
3. **Assemble** — supporting evidence, counterevidence and alternatives.
4. **Challenge** — strongest counterposition, harm review and right of reply.
5. **Evaluate** — bounded verdict, action, impact, monitoring and correction.

## Priority test

Six dimensions receive 0–5 points:

- possible harm;
- evidence access;
- actionability;
- urgency;
- public value;
- fairness and review capacity.

The score ranks public value and investigability. It never represents truth, guilt or publication readiness.

## Impact

[`impact_log.json`](impact_log.json) records separate 30, 90 and 365 day checkpoints for:

1. evidence impact;
2. accountability impact;
3. behaviour or policy impact;
4. animal outcome impact.

Reach remains separate from animal-welfare outcomes.
